Е-Комерція (Електронний бізнес)

Симетричне шифрування

Симетричні методи шифрування зручні тим, що для забезпечення високого рівня безпеки передачі даних не потрібно створювати ключі ве­ликої довжини. Це дозволяє швидко шифрувати і дешифрувати великі обсяги інформації.

При цьому і відправник, і одержувач інформації повинні володіти тим самим ключем. Для початку роботи із застосуванням симетричного алгоритму сторонам необхідно безпечно обмінятися секретним ключем, що легко зробити при особистій зустрічі, але досить важко при необхід­ності передати ключ через які-небудь засоби зв’язку.

Схема роботи із застосуванням симетричного алгоритму шифрування складається з наступних етапів:

•   сторони встановлюють на своїх комп’ютерах програмне забезпечення, що забезпечує шифрування, дешифрування даних і первинну генерацію секретних ключів;

•    генерується секретний ключ і поширюється між учас­никами інформаційного обміну; іноді генерується список одноразових ключів; у цьому випадку для кожного сеансу пе­редачі інформації використовується унікальний ключ; при цьому на початку кожного сеансу відправник сповіщає отри­мувача порядковий номер ключа, який він застосував у дано­му повідомленні;

•   відправник шифрує інформацію за допомогою встанов­леного програмного забезпечення, що реалізує симетричний алгоритм шифрування;

•    зашифрована інформація передається одержувачеві по каналам зв’язку;

•    одержувач дешифрує інформацію, використовуючи той же ключ, що й відправник.

Алгоритми симетричного шифрування:

•    DES (Data Encryption Standard). Розроблений фірмою IBM і широко використовується з 1977 року. Є зараз застарі­лим, оскільки застосовувана в ньому довжина ключа недостат­ня для забезпечення стабільності по відношенню до розкриття методом повного перебору всіх можливих значень ключа. Роз­криття цього алгоритму стало можливим завдяки потужному розвитку обчислювальної техніки після 1977 року.

•    Triple DES. Це вдосконалений варіант DES, що викорис­товує для шифрування алгоритм DES три рази з різними клю­чами. Він значно стійкіше до злому, ніж DES;

•    Rijndael. Алгоритм розроблено у Бельгії. Працює із клю­чами довжиною 128, 192 і 256 біт. На даний момент до нього немає претензій у фахівців з криптографії;

•    Skipjack. Алгоритм створено і використовується Агент­ством національної безпеки США. Довжина ключа 80 біт. Шифрування і дешифрування інформації провадиться циклічно (32 циклу);

•    IDEA. Алгоритм запатентовано у США і ряді європейсь­ких країн. Власник патенту - компанія Ascom-Tech. Алгоритм використовує циклічну обробку інформації (8 циклів) шля­хом застосування до неї ряду математичних операцій;

•    RC4. Алгоритм спеціально розроблений для швидкого шифрування великих обсягів інформації. Він використовує ключ змінної довжини (залежно від необхідного ступеня за­хисту інформації) і працює значно швидше інших алгоритмів.

RC4 відноситься до так званих потокових шифрів.

 

« Содержание


 ...  41  ... 


по автору: А Б В Г Д Е Ё Ж З И Й К Л М Н О П Р С Т У Ф Х Ц Ч Ш Щ Э Ю Я

по названию: А Б В Г Д Е Ё Ж З И Й К Л М Н О П Р С Т У Ф Х Ц Ч Ш Щ Э Ю Я